Kazakov" Newsgroups: comp.lang.ada Subject: T'Interface attribute Date: Wed, 2 Aug 2017 15:43:37 +0200 Organization: Aioe.org NNTP Server Message-ID: NNTP-Posting-Host: MajGvm9MbNtGBKE7r8NgYA.user.gioia.aioe.org Mime-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=utf-8; format=flowed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it X-Complaints-To: abuse@aioe.org User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; WOW64; rv:52.0) Gecko/20100101 Thunderbird/52.2.1 X-Mozilla-News-Host: news://news.aioe.org:119 Content-Language: en-US X-Notice: Filtered by postfilter v. 0.8.2 Xref: news.eternal-september.org comp.lang.ada:47556 Date: 2017-08-02T15:43:37+02:00 List-Id: In order to reduce name space contamination I would propose attribute T'Interface which for any tagged type T would denote an interface type with all *new* primitive operations, e.g. type Derived is new Parent with ...; not overriding procedure Foo (X : Derived); is equivalent to type Derived'Interface is [limited etc] interface; procedure Foo (X : Derived'Interface); type Derived is new Parent and Derived'Interface with ...; T'Interface is visible at the declaration point of T. Its use is same as of T. E.g. prior to the freezing point of T is "premature". Question. If T has any discriminants so does T'Interface. -- Regards, Dmitry A. Kazakov http://www.dmitry-kazakov.de
